Mississippi's excise tax per pack of cigarettes: $0.180
Mississippi's excise tax collection for the
fiscal year ending June 2002: $47,071,000
Sales tax on tobacco products: 7.00%
Federal excise tax per pack of cigarettes: $0.39
Total federal excise tax collections in fiscal year 2002: $7,512,700,000
Comparing Excise Taxes on Cigarettes, Beer and WineNumber of six-packs of beer that must be sold in Mississippi to produce the same state excise tax revenue generated by one carton of cigarettes: 7.5
Number of bottles of wine that must be sold in Mississippi to produce the same state excise tax revenue generated by one carton of cigarettes: 26
